=Thoughts on {{PAGENAME}}=
==={{PAGENAME}} in a nutshell===
The modulator is an anti-infantry jack, electrocuting lines of infantry but not hitting as hard as any of the other heavies in melee. It's best thought of as a light on steroids, with the cost and hitting power of a light warjack even if it has the bulk and damage of a heavy.
 
It’s the cheapest heavy in faction and you get what you pay for; it’s guns can only really be used against infantry due to their power and in melee it hits at a similar level to a light Warjack. Additionally due to its reliance on electrical damage it has some very poor match ups in the form of [[Krueger2]] and the [[Storm Division]] theme.
 
===Combos & Synergies===
* Its guns, plasma nimbus and direct current all benefit from Ionization Servitors launched by a [[Prime Conflux]].
* [[Destructotron 3000]] makes it more accurate.
* Aperture Beams from [[Iron Mother Directrix]]'s Exponent Servitors also boost the relatively weak attacks of the Modulator.  The combined effect of Ionization and Exponent Servitors substantially strengthen the Modulator.
* Fire Group from Iron Mother means he can get the direct current farther, getting more infantry under the line.
* [[Syntherion]] because it’s guns effect is not considered to have come from an attack it does not work with hot shot. However on feat turn it can charge in to stack Synergy, deal a respectable amount of damage and then shoot twice with dual attack. It’s attacks are not high quality, but sometimes quantity has its own value.
* [[Eminent Configurator Orion]] can buff the Accuracy and Damage output of the Modulator with his feat. Additional die to hit infantry, and additional die to damage enemy heavies or warcasters can be a surprising amount of punch out of a 10-point vector. Mage Sight, Spellpiercer and Magic Bullet can also ensure that the Modulators can scalpel out just about anything at range.
 
===Drawbacks & Downsides===
* It's too pillow fisted to really qualify as a heavy jack.
* Gets shut down by lightning immunity
* Plasma nimbus won't do anything to protect you from heavies
* If the shootiness is what you are after then the [[Tesselator]] costs seven rather than nine points, has a longer threat range, and hits harder with its guns even if it doesn't have the anti-infantry lines.
 
===Tricks & Tips===
Use "Direct Current" from your Emitter Surge to take out high DEF or Stealth models.  You do need to score a direct hit on your actual target -- if there is not a good enemy model to target and hit, don't forget you can line things up to target one of your own models and damage enemy models between them.

Resistance-Electricity
Resistance-Electricity
  • When this model suffers an electrical damage roll, remove one die from the damage roll.
  • Lightning cannot arc from this model.
  • Lightning cannot arc to this model (ignore this model when determining arcing lightning)

Pathfinder
Pathfinder
This model treats rough terrain as open terrain while advancing. While charging, slam power attacking, or trample power attacking, this model does not stop its movement when it contacts an obstacle.

Dual Attack
Dual Attack

This model can make melee and ranged attacks in the same activation. When this model makes its initial melee attacks, it can also make its initial ranged attacks. A model with Dual Attack can make its initial melee and ranged attacks in any order you choose. This model cannot make ranged attacks after making a power attack.

  Errata-Dual Attack and Unit Charges (2023-10-27)
Question: If a unit with Dual Attack charges a single model, are all placed in melee range, and the first model kills the charge target, can the remaining members of the unit make ranged attacks, or do they forfeit their Combat Action because they don't have any enemy models in their melee range?
Answer: The check for melee range is done at the end of movement. If you kill the targets before they attack, they can still do their ranged attack. (Malkav13)
Explanation: This post is correct.
Infernal Ruling: elswickchuck (Bulldog) - PP Community forum


  Errata-Dual Attack and Special Attacks (2023-08-10)
Question: Can a model with Dual Attack make any combination of ranged special attack and normal melee initial attacks, or its melee special attack and normal ranged initial attacks? (Example: Bison Both Barrels and Ram, or Mariner Thresher and gunshot).
Answer: No.
Explanation: The bison can not use dual attack and also make a special attack. That is correct in that (Thresher) example too.

Plasma Nimbus
If this model is hit by a melee attack, immediately after the attack is resolved you can choose to have the attacking model suffer a POW 10 electrical damage roll unless this model was destroyed or removed from play by the attack.

Emitter Surge
 RNG   ROF   AOE   POW   LOCATION 
11 1 - 10 Left and Right (1 initial each)

Direct Current
If this attack directly hits, you can choose to have all models whose bases are intersected by a line drawn between the center of the model directly hit and the center of this model suffer an unboostable POW 10 electrical damage roll. This damage is not considered to have been caused by an attack. Resolve Direct Current damage rolls simultaneously with the damage resulting from the attack that caused it.

  Errata-Direct Current (2024-2-19)
Question: Direct Current specifies that a line is drawn from base center to base center, and all models intersected by the line would suffer a POW 10. Do the attacking and target models suffer the POW 10?
Answer: The attacking and defending models do not take a POW 10 from Direct Current.

Warjack Rules

Convergence of Cyriss warjacks are called vectors. While being a "Vector" isn't a gameplay rule, the Convergence warjacks do carry some additional rules of their own that set them apart from normal warjacks.


Interface Node
  1. This model has an interface node instead of a cortex, represented by the I boxes on the damage grid.
  2. This model gains focus, and can have no more than 3 points at any time.
  3. This model can spend focus only during its activation.
  4. This model cannot gain or spend focus while its interface node is crippled.
  5. This model is immune to effects that cause a warjack to suffer damage directly to its cortex.
  6. This model is immune to effects that require a warjack to have a functional cortex.

No errata for Interface Node (Create)


Warcaster Dependent MAT and RAT
  1. This model's MAT and RAT are equal to the current MAT and RAT of its controlling warcaster.
  2. This model does not directly benefit from MAT/RAT bonuses, but any alteration to a controlling warcaster's MAT/RAT will be passed along to this model.
  3. Effects that affect attack rolls will affect this model normally.

    No errata for Warcaster Dependent MAT and RAT (Create)


No Power Up
This model does not power up and does not automatically gain a focus point for being in the controlling warcaster's control range during the Control Phase.

No errata for No Power Up (Create)


Force Induction
When this model spends a focus point during its activation, you can give a focus point to another warjack with an operational interface node if the two are in the same battlegroup and are within 9 inches of one another. This does not override the Interface Node rule limiting the warjack's focus points to 3.

Lore

The arcane displacer drive represented a major breakthrough in vector design. Freed from the hampering influence of gravity, heavy vectors equipped with this technology—such as the Conservator, Assimilator, and Modulator—gain unparalleled freedom of movement. Coruscating with electrostatic energy along its hull, the Modulator can channel this charge into a bolt of pure energy that electrocutes everything in its path.
